The M2Eclipse website is a Jekyll-based website that is primarily written in the Markdown format, with a bit of plain HTML.
You can use any Markdown editor for the developer-centric pages (*.md
), and all normal Jekyll commands will work to build/render the site.
You can also use the script provided to run the Java implementation of Jekyll if you don't want to install Ruby/Jekyll on your system.
./jekyll.sh
Now you can go to http:localhost:4000 to see the site.
